+// AbslStringify()
+//
+// A simpler customization API for formatting user-defined types using
+// absl::StrFormat(). The API relies on detecting an overload in the
+// user-defined type's namespace of a free (non-member) `AbslStringify()`
+// function as a friend definition with the following signature:
+//
+// template <typename Sink>
+// void AbslStringify(Sink& sink, const X& value);
+//
+// An `AbslStringify()` overload for a type should only be declared in the same
+// file and namespace as said type.
+//
+// Note that unlike with AbslFormatConvert(), AbslStringify() does not allow
+// customization of allowed conversion characters. AbslStringify() uses `%v` as
+// the underlying conversion specififer. Additionally, AbslStringify() supports
+// use with absl::StrCat while AbslFormatConvert() does not.
+//
+// Example:
+//
+// struct Point {
+// // To add formatting support to `Point`, we simply need to add a free
+// // (non-member) function `AbslStringify()`. This method prints in the
+// // request format using the underlying `%v` specifier. You can add such a
+// // free function using a friend declaration within the body of the class.
+// // The sink parameter is a templated type to avoid requiring dependencies.
+// template <typename Sink>
+// friend void AbslStringify(Sink& sink, const Point& p) {
+// absl::Format(&sink, "(%v, %v)", p.x, p.y);
+// }
+//
+// int x;
+// int y;
+// };
+//
